People Also Ask about
How do you write a good reply brief?
Reprise. A good reply brief should reprise the themes of the opening brief, using a short introduction to set the stage. That introduction is a handy place to point out arguments that the appellee fails to address, or concessions that he is forced to make.
What is the federal rule for reply briefs?
A reply brief must contain a table of contents, with page references, and a table of authorities — cases (alphabetically arranged), statutes, and other authorities — with references to the pages of the reply brief where they are cited.
How do you write a reply brief?
Your reply brief should be both concise and comprehensive, in which you refute your adversary's arguments, highlight the most favorable facts and law, and re-enforce the theme of your case.
What is the introduction of the reply brief?
It is recommended you start the reply brief with a short introduction summarizing the arguments you made in the opening brief, the arguments the Attorney General made in the respondent's brief, and why your arguments are more persuasive.
What happens after a reply brief?
Next Steps After the Appellant's Reply Brief All parties who file a brief that the Court of Appeal accepts will have an opportunity to make an oral argument. This is a chance for the parties to talk to the Court of Appeal justices in person and explain the arguments in their briefs.
What does "brief reply" mean?
: a brief that is filed with the plaintiff's reply and that sets forth the arguments in support thereof.
Does a reply brief need an introduction?
The Court of Appeal will ignore any new legal issues or repeated arguments found in the appellant's reply brief. It's best to start with an introduction. This should be a short summary of the reply argument. Next, the appellant should reply to specific legal issues in the respondent's brief.
